What is the best time to close a trade in the London cryptocurrency market?
In the London cryptocurrency market, when is the most optimal time to close a trade? I want to maximize my profits and minimize potential losses. Are there specific hours or periods during the day when the market is more active or volatile? How can I take advantage of these trends to make informed decisions about when to close my trades?
3 answers
- socBuilderJan 19, 2025 · a year agoThe best time to close a trade in the London cryptocurrency market is during peak trading hours, which are typically between 8:00 AM and 4:00 PM GMT. During these hours, the market is usually more active and volatile, providing better opportunities for profit. However, it's important to note that cryptocurrency markets can be unpredictable, and there is no guarantee of success. It's essential to stay updated with market trends, news, and analysis to make informed decisions about when to close your trades.
